## What Are the Benefits of Coloring for Stress Relief? Coloring has been shown to have a positive impact on mental health and stress relief. According to a study published in the Journal of Art & Design Education, coloring can reduce symptoms of anxiety and depression in adults. The repetitive motion of coloring can be meditative, allowing the mind to focus on the present moment and let go of worries about the past or future. Here are some tips to help you get the most out of your coloring experience: 1. **Choose a quiet space**: Find a cozy spot where you can sit comfortably and focus on your coloring without distractions. 2. **Select your colors**: Pick a palette that resonates with you, whether it's bright and bold or soft and pastel. 3. **Start simple**: Begin with a simple design and gradually move on to more complex patterns as you become more comfortable. 4. **Be mindful**: Focus on the present moment and let go of any self-criticism - it's okay if your coloring isn't perfect!
